Hi I read up on how to setup a tile server with the least hassle. It is quite a bit involved according to this guide: https://switch2osm.org/manually-building-a-tile-server-18-04-lts/
I imagine this could be more fully automated with guix if we find a way to run the pgsql-commands from guile and write the necessary services. We have most of the bits and pieces already but I spotted a few that were missing while reading and thought I would share them here: * mod_tile (apache plugin) https://github.com/openstreetmap/mod_tile * carto (uses npm and node) https://www.npmjs.com/package/carto (7 dependencies - at least 1 with a lot of dependencies (yargs)) * openstreetmap-carto (contain carto-css styles and a lua-script useful for tag-transformation when loading pbf-files into a postgis database with osm2pgsql and get-shapefiles.py a script to download low-zoom country boundaries) https://github.com/gravitystorm/openstreetmap-carto/ This last one should perhaps be included in our osm2pgsql-package because it is hard to imagine someone using one but not the other. It seems we need a renderd-service also. Thoughts? -- Cheers Swedebugia
